Civil Engineer Salary in Spokane, Washington

The median civil engineer salary in Spokane, WA is $82,745 per year, which is 8% below the national median and 20% below the Washington state average.

Civil Engineer Salary in Spokane by Experience

In Spokane, an entry-level civil engineer earns around $57,040, while experienced professionals earn up to $119,600 per year. The local cost of living index is 92% of the national average.
